This dataset provides Census 2021 estimates that classify households in England and Wales by the number of disabled people in the household. The estimates are as at Census Day, 21 March 2021.

Summary

The number of people in a household who assessed their day-to-day activities as limited by long-term physical or mental health conditions or illnesses and are considered disabled. This definition of a disabled person meets the harmonised standard for measuring disability and is in line with the Equality Act (2010).

Number of disabled people in household: Total: All households 137
No people disabled under the Equality Act in household 70
1 person disabled under the Equality Act in household 49
2 or more people disabled under the Equality Act in household 18
